What is the best way to make pizza on a gas grill?

Grilling the Perfect Pizza on Your Gas Grill:

Here's a breakdown of how to make the best pizza on your gas grill:

1. Prep Your Pizza:

* The Dough: Use store-bought or homemade pizza dough. Let it come to room temperature for about 30 minutes before shaping.

* The Sauce: Opt for a simple tomato sauce or get creative with pesto, barbecue sauce, or Alfredo.

* The Cheese: Choose your favorite mozzarella or a blend of cheeses like provolone, cheddar, or parmesan.

* The Toppings: Get creative! Fresh vegetables, meats, herbs, and even fruits can be delicious toppings.

2. Prepare Your Grill:

* Heat the Grill: Preheat your gas grill to high heat (around 500-550°F).

* Use a Pizza Stone: For a crispy crust, place a pizza stone or a baking sheet on the grill grates. Let it heat up for at least 15 minutes.

* Clean the Grates: Make sure your grill grates are clean and free of debris. This will prevent your pizza from sticking.

3. Assemble and Bake:

* Shape and Spread: Stretch the dough to your desired size, then place it on the hot pizza stone.

* Sauce and Cheese: Spread your sauce evenly, leaving a small border around the edge. Sprinkle on the cheese.

* Toppings: Arrange your toppings on top of the cheese.

* Close the Lid: Close the grill lid and bake for 5-8 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the cheese is melted and bubbly.

4. Tips and Tricks:

* Rotation: Rotate the pizza 180 degrees halfway through baking to ensure even cooking.

* Grill Marks: For that extra char, lightly grill the pizza directly on the grates for a few minutes before transferring it to the pizza stone.

Bonus Tip: For a smoky flavor, place a handful of wood chips in a foil packet and put it on the grill grates before heating the pizza stone.
